44.6 Problems with Internet Access

Table 144 Troubleshooting Internet Access

PROBLEM

CORRECTIVE ACTION

 

 

I cannot access

Make sure the Prestige is turned on and connected to the network.

the Internet.

If the DSL LED is off, refer to .

 

 

Verify your WAN settings. Refer to the chapter on WAN setup (web configurator) or

 

the section on Internet Access (SMT).

 

Make sure you entered the correct user name and password.

 

If you use PPPoE pass through, make sure that bridge is turned on. See Chapter 23

 

on page 273 for details.

 

For wireless stations, check that both the Prestige and wireless station(s) are using

 

the same ESSID, channel, WEP keys (if WEP encryption is activated) and

 

authentication method.

Internet

Check the schedule rules. Refer to Chapter 41 on page 399 (SMT).

connection

If you use PPPoA or PPPoE encapsulation, check the idle time-out setting. Refer to

disconnects.

Chapter 7 on page 109 (web configurator) or Chapter 28 on page 295 (SMT).

 

 

Contact your ISP.

 

 

44.7 Problems with the Password

Table 145 Troubleshooting the Password

PROBLEM

CORRECTIVE ACTION

 

 

I cannot

The username is “admin”. The default password is “1234”. The Password and

access the

Username fields are case-sensitive. Make sure that you enter the correct password

Prestige.

and username using the proper casing.

 

If you have changed the password and have now forgotten it, you will need to upload

 

the default configuration file (Refer to Section 2.1.2 on page 58). This restores all of

 

the factory defaults including the password.
